I have a very simple, “quick and dirty” OpenGL test program written for Windows using GLUT. It draws two colored rectangles that orbit around the X axis and the orbit position is varied by pressing ‘a’ or ‘z’.
Initially I had not set glEnable(GL_DEPTH_TEST), so the rectangles were appearing in the order they were drawn.
The problem is that when I set that, the display becomes totally random, it draws either the first rectangle or the second or neither of them without any logic. I’m sure there is something I am doing wrong, but I have no clue what…
